Puffed Spelt

Puffed spelt is a whole grain snack made from spelt wheat that has been puffed through heat and pressure. It retains the nutritional benefits of spelt, including fiber and protein, making it a healthy alternative to traditional snacks.

Rich in dietary fiber, which aids in digestion and helps maintain a healthy gut.
Contains essential nutrients such as protein, iron, and magnesium, supporting overall health and wellness.

Amaranth Bread Loaf

Amaranth bread is a nutritious gluten-free alternative made from amaranth flour, known for its high protein and fiber content. It offers a unique nutty flavor and is rich in essential nutrients.

Rich in protein, amaranth bread supports muscle repair and growth, making it an excellent choice for athletes and active individuals.
High fiber content aids in digestion and helps maintain a healthy weight by promoting satiety.
